Default Problem : Car just started pooring out smoke.

Hey guys, my 98 Pontiac Bonneville SE just started this random new thing! It just started pouring smoke while I drive and while its in park. It just started recently, I just put in new spark plug wires along with spark plugs and an oil change. The dad said "the gas is burning" but i have no idea where to start and look for that. All input is needed and appreciated.

Thanks

What color is the smoke? White, blueish, gray? Can you smell anything? Carbon, oil, sweet(coolant)?

Its white;blueish but I really can't distinguish the smell to be honest with you.

Bluish would be oil. Does it smoke all the time or just for a short time after starting the car?

Well i sometimes when i start my car it like almost stalls, like it revs itself from low to high but really quick. Then I save my car by giving it a little gas and that white bluish smoke comes out. Then i dont see it for awhile. And then today, I was working on my car and I dont know why it started doing it but it did. I let it idle for like 10 min and it was just smoking, not tons of it, but a good amount. And I went down the road to see if it would go away, and it still was coming out.

Sounds like you have a valve seal going out.

Are they easy to repair? And where are they located?

Under the valve covers. Not to hard if you have the right tools. But pulling the heads is the safest way to do it.
